diff options
author | Dimitry Ivanov <dimitry@google.com> | 2017-05-18 16:22:20 +0000 |
---|---|---|
committer | Android (Google) Code Review <android-gerrit@google.com> | 2017-05-18 16:22:21 +0000 |
commit | f80b2bae2f85fc958c06b6fad1dbb536593dbf4f (patch) | |
tree | d304fa4fbe8a55cf8668c539a114507eeb0be287 | |
parent | f963bc3833951e78558de87e0c8fca589572ccf8 (diff) | |
parent | ec5ddc0a2334aaf7a36cbf99deb668e13e5cd717 (diff) | |
download | bionic-f80b2bae2f85fc958c06b6fad1dbb536593dbf4f.tar.gz |
Merge "Revert "linker: remove link from external library on unload"" into oc-dev
-rw-r--r-- | linker/linker.cpp | 3 |
1 files changed, 0 insertions, 3 deletions
diff --git a/linker/linker.cpp b/linker/linker.cpp index 9a6543c11..c6616241b 100644 --- a/linker/linker.cpp +++ b/linker/linker.cpp @@ -1775,9 +1775,6 @@ static void soinfo_unload(soinfo* soinfos[], size_t count) { if (local_unload_list.contains(child)) { continue; } else if (child->is_linked() && child->get_local_group_root() != root) { - child->get_parents().remove_if([&] (const soinfo* parent) { - return parent == si; - }); external_unload_list.push_back(child); } else if (child->get_parents().empty()) { unload_list.push_back(child); |